Just installed from scratch an ASUS P5W DH with a Core 2 Duo E6600/Corsair TWIN2X2048-6400PRO/2xSeagate SATA-II 7200.10 320GB.
Very nice board and everything went well except for the RAID setup. I decided to use the Intel ICH7R RAID solution and diligently copied the needed files to a floppy using ASUS utility CD.
I also set the RAID option in the BIOS as specified in the manual. To be double sure I disabled the EZ-Backup and Jmiron RAID options.
During Windows XP Professional installation after pressing F6 and being prompted to insert the floppy I don't get the driver specified in the manual, which is:
Intel® 82801 GH/GM SATA RAID Controller (Desktop ICH7R/DH)
Instead I get four others, including (seemingly best match):
Intel® ICH8R/DO/DH SATA RAID Controller (Desktop ICH8R)
But trying this driver (and the others) leads to no SATAs detected and an early exit from Windows XP setup....
On the Intel homepage I have so far failed to find the exact driver I need...there are all sorts of other ones with names that are nearly the same. But not exactly the right one...maybe trying the best matches and see...
Why would ASUS not deliver the required RAID drivers on their utility CD...or indeed, why would they include drivers that don't work?
